Lemon Garlic Shrimp

By: Lynn Corsaro  
"Shrimp, pepper and a tasty lemon sauce dress up a packaged broccoli rice mix in this speedy main course. I found the recipe years ago and have served it numerous times, always with success, notes Lynn Corsaro of Florence, Colorado. Its a cinch to double for company, and guests always rave about it."

Prep Time:
20 Min
Cook Time:
10 Min
Ready In:
30 Min

Original Recipe Yield 4 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1 (6.5 ounce) package RICE-A-RONI® Broccoli Au Gratin
  • 1 pound uncooked medium sh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 medium sweet red pepper, julienned
  • 3 green onions,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
  • 1 teaspoon minced garlic
  • 1/2 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 2 teaspoons cornstarch
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on grated lemon peel, divided

Directions

  1. Prepare rice mix according to package directions. Meanwhile, in a large skillet, saute the shrimp, red pepper, onions, garlic and Italian seasoning in butter until shrimp turn pink.
  2. In a small bowl, combine the cornstarch, broth and lemon juice until smooth; stir into shrimp mixture.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 1-2 minutes or until thickened. Stir 1/2 teaspoon lemon peel into prepared rice. Serve with shrimp mixture; sprinkle with remaining lemon peel.

Footnotes

  • Nutrition Facts: 1 serving (prepared with reduced-fat butter and reduced-sodium broth) equals 321 calories, 10 g fat (5 g saturated fat), 186 mg cholesterol, 907 mg sodium, 35 g carbohydrate, 2 g fiber, 24 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 3 lean meat, 2 starch, 1 vegetable.
